A huge percentage of players never ever do anything with their Exalted orbs but trade them away. This tends to accumulate among the wealthiest, longest-playing, 00.01%. Also, having a 300ex character or 100ex of currency doesn't mean you once had 400 exalts. There's probably an order of magnitude less currency in PoE than would be needed for everyone to trade all their junk at once.
It doesn't take as many players (or bots) as you think to make all the currency available in PoE, especially Standard where it has had quite a while to accumulate and trickle up into the hands of the super wealthy. Last edited by KG31459#1353 on Feb 10, 2014, 11:41:25 AM

I've played an average of 2-3 hours a day... Since closed beta.
I tend to find the following... Exalted: 1 every 1-2 months Divine: 1 every 3 months GCP: Used to be one per week, now it is one per 3 weeks Blessed: 1-2 per week Regal: 1-2 per week Regret: 1 every 2 days Chaos: 2-3 per hour Alch: 2-3 perhour Fusing: 2-3 per hour Chance: this one changes way too much to figure out. Sometimes I drop 8 in an hour, sometimes I dont see one for 2 days. |
